Output 4118087893d48974366c7b9ae52647d641403f971cf15fd12143f345f64798ed:2

value
2573283
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e08100b5ea7012eb9f8ebdd887a2dd7b1e3f3e23 OP_EQUALVERIFY OP_CHECKSIG
address
1MU4uEvQfS1jUasuFwqip9BV5exkmhZc7U
transaction
4118087893d48974366c7b9ae52647d641403f971cf15fd12143f345f64798ed
confirmations
399894
spent
true